PAN Card Mandatory For Private Firms Seeking Central Excise Registration
05 May, New Delhi
Permanent Account Number, PAN has been made mandatory for private firms seeking central excise registration.
As per the rules, the registration will now be given within two days of filing online applications to improve the ease in doing business in manufacturing.
Finance Ministry order said, applicants seeking registration shall mandatorily quote PAN of the proprietor or the legal entity being registered in the application form.
However the government departments are exempted from the requirement of quoting PAN in their online application. It said, applicants other than government departments shall not be granted registration in the absence of PAN.
Applicant shall also quote his e-mail address and mobile number in the application form for communication with the department.
Under the new procedure, once duly completed application form is received online, registration would be granted within two working days and issued online without any examination of the documents and verification of documents or premises before the grant of registration.
